Where does “چايدان” come from?

چايدان (Uyghur) comes from Persian چایدان, from Persian چای, from Hindi चाय, from Middle Chinese 茶, from Chinese 茶, from Proto-Loloish la¹, from Proto-Sino-Tibetan s-la — leaf; tea; flat object.

چايدان (Uyghur): thermos
